Prepare yourself for a deeply moving evening of music. On Dec. 2, the University Singers will perform a program of works for voices and string orchestra. The featured piece on the program will be Arvo Part's ethereal and meditative Stabat Mater. A deeply spiritual composer, who found his own musical language with "a love of every note" at its heart, Part is one of the most performed living composers of his time.
